“…The 5S tool consists of five elements: sort (classification of objects as waste, rarely used pieces and necessary pieces), set in order (establish a working environment that involves discipline, cleanliness and timely preparation for operation), shine (cleaning, painting and routine maintenance of the working space and environment), standardize (defining and standardizing procedures related to the working process, tasks and activities), and sustain (implement and maintain the 5S tool at the institutional and organizational level of the enterprise) [7]. The use of 5S tool results in less human effort, space, and capital, shorter processing time, and fewer mistakes, and can be a starting platform for the integrated management system [20].…”
